For sale is an original GM front disc brake set takeoff from a 1967 Camaro L78 that I believe is a pro-touring build. I was going to use these on my car but I found a set of rebuilt calipers and figured this front disc brake set should stay together for another car. This kit needs restoring but looks to be all there with exception of a missing bracket to caliper bolt, and two washers for the bracket to caliper bolts on that same side.

Both sides look to have original GM parts including calipers with no repairs, two piece rotors, spindles, brackets, brake hose brackets, hardware, and power steering arms.
